Popular Welding Certificates
While the American Welding Society’s normal Certified Welder certificate opens the door for most job opportunities, a number of fields demand their own specialized certification. A handful of the most-well-known of them are highlighted below.
- American Petroleum Institute Certification for welders who deal with pipelines in the gas and oil field
- ASME Certification for welders that work with boiler and pressure containers
- SCWI and CWI Certifications for Welding Inspectors and Senior Welding Inspectors
- Certified Welder Certificates to be a Certified Welder

Exactly What Will Be involved in Your welding specialist Classes?
Determining which classes to go to generally is a personal choice, however here are some things that you should know about prior to deciding on certified welding schools. Picking welding specialist training may well appear easy, yet you need to ensure that that you’re deciding on the right style of training. It is heavily recommended that you take the time to be sure you verify that the welder training program or school you’re going to be thinking about has been approved by the AWS or some other regulatory organization. Some other areas that you will wish to check out apart from the accreditation status may include:
- Make sure the school teaches on technology that satisfies present field guidelines
- Learn if the institution gives financial aid
- Confirm the college’s program offers courses in GTAW, SMAW, pipe welding and GMAW
- Try to find programs that fulfill AWS SENSE standards
